A hydrovac truck brings a specific capability to Foggy Bottom: truck-mounted hydro excavation. Pressurized water cuts the soil while a powerful vacuum lifts the spoil, exposing utilities without striking them. For construction and municipal work across District of Columbia County, it is often the right tool for the job.

Before you dig in Foggy Bottom

Before any excavation in Foggy Bottom, the law requires marking buried utilities through Miss Utility. Contact them at 811 ahead of digging. The District of Columbia requires 2 working days advance notice through Miss Utility. Service providers booked through Vac Hotline handle locates as part of a properly run job.

What is a hydrovac truck used for?

Hydrovac trucks safely expose and excavate around buried utilities using pressurized water and a vacuum, instead of a mechanical bucket that could strike a gas, power, or fiber line. Common jobs are potholing, daylighting, slot trenching, and deep excavation near live lines.

Is hydrovac excavation safe around gas and power lines?

Yes. Because the cut is made with water and the spoil is removed by suction, no metal tool contacts the utility. This is why hydrovac (a form of non-destructive excavation) is the accepted method for digging near marked underground infrastructure.
